    Tom started building the Dyna Ski in 1995-6.

    The Dyna-Ski web site is not Tom's. His boats are called "the Dyne" since about 05 or 06.

    The "new" Dyna-Ski's I have seen were apperently built by:

    http://www.uscgboating.org/recalls/mic_detail.aspx?id=OQV

    The Serial number starts with OQV on the boats I have seen, and it is stamped into the transom.

    Tom's boats have a serial number that starts with FPD.

    http://www.uscgboating.org/recalls/mic_detail.aspx?id=FPD

    That was probably Tom that you talked to.

    I don't know too much about the new Dyna-Ski. I believe they got a 17.6 and a 20 mold from Three Rivers (Hydrodyne) when they quit building outboards. It looks like they have modified it.

    Tom has an original 20 mold also. It has gone through some mods I believe.

    The 18 mold belongs to a third party. I believe Tom built a new deck mold and he uses the 18 mold to build 18's. The last time I checked it was at his shop.

    Skip (Riverside Composites) owns the hull mold for the 18 footer and he redesigned the deck mold with the rounded bulkhead area where the pylon goes. I saw the mold about 2 years ago at his place. I doubt he would ever part with it, but you never know.
